A Traditional Polish Delight
Klopsiki, or Polish meatballs, have been a staple in Polish households for generations. They are typically made with a mix of ground beef and pork, flavored with fresh dill and spices, and cooked in a delicious creamy gravy. This dish is often served with mashed potatoes or buckwheat, making it a complete and comforting meal.

Ideas for Toppings
Enhance your klopsiki with some delicious toppings. A sprinkle of fresh dill or parsley adds a burst of flavor and color. A dollop of sour cream can make the dish even creamier, while a side of pickles provides a nice tangy contrast. For an extra touch, sprinkle some grated cheese over the top just before serving.

How To Store and Serve Klopsiki
Proper storage and serving tips can help you enjoy klopsiki at their best:

Storage Tips:

Store leftover meatballs in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ently on the stovetop or in the microwave until hot.

Serving Tips:

Serve the meatballs hot, garnished with fresh herbs and a dollop of sour cream. Pair them with boiled dill potatoes, mashed potatoes, buckwheat, or a fresh salad for a complete meal.
